Output 63a33633d54f1e09cb8393640001af8e5ee5c6d2dc7c414177fe511472bd8c37:0

value
1530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ec0f5d810da650ab9574c6830f2e42095fd9d84c OP_EQUAL
address
3PDBoQrPawWBaqSzL4buWt1k8AZ1QRiYR6
transaction
63a33633d54f1e09cb8393640001af8e5ee5c6d2dc7c414177fe511472bd8c37
spent
true